MEA adjusts flight schedule for July 5–6-7 due to operational reasons

LBCI02-07-2025
Middle East Airlines announced changes to its flight schedule for July 5, 6, and 7, 2025, due to operational reasons. The adjustments are as follows:
The morning flight to and from Amman (ME310/ME311) scheduled for July 5 will be canceled. Passengers will be rebooked on the afternoon flight ME312/ME313 on the same day, with the option to change their travel date to any other day at no additional cost.
The midday flight to and from Baghdad (ME320/ME321) scheduled for July 5 will also be canceled. Passengers will be transferred to the afternoon flight ME322/ME323 on the same day, with the same option to modify their travel date without extra charges.
Additionally, the departure times for certain flights on July 5, 6, and 7 to Nice, Jeddah, Larnaca, Athens, and Rome will be adjusted.

MEA flights connecting Beirut to eight destinations modified between July 26 and 30

The national airline Middle East Airlines (MEA) announced Monday that some of its flights connecting Beirut to eight destinations will be modified between July 26 and 30 for "operational" reasons. "For operational reasons, the schedules of several flights to and from Paris, Nice, Istanbul, Doha, Larnaca, Jeddah, Accra-Abidjan and Cairo will be modified during the period from July 26 to 30," MEA said in a statement, without providing further details. Some flights will be advanced or delayed, it added. During the 12-day war between Iran and Israel in June, MEA maintained its flights to and from Beirut, though it modified its schedules due to disruptions affecting the regional airspace. During the 2023-2024 war between Israel and Hezbollah, the national airline was the only carrier to maintain service to Beirut following the Israeli escalation on the capital.
